GIRLS SOCCER: Strong second half helps Divine Child pull away from local rival Crestwood
DEARBORN HEIGHTS – As the high school girls’ soccer regular season winds down, a couple of squads squared off in some non-league action on Friday as Dearborn Divine Child made the roughly half-mile journey west to face off with Dearborn Heights Crestwood.
